Educating Teachers for Leadership and Change Summary

Educating Teachers for Leadership and Change: Teacher Education Yearbook III by Mary John O'Hair

New ground is broken in every section...a toast to professionalism. From the Foreword by Thomas J. Sergiovanni Trinity University Explores these important topics: * Occupational stress * Special preparation of urban teachers * Peer coaching and evaluation * Communication skills * Workplace barriers to leadership development, and much more. Well-organized and straightforward, this volume offers you highly enjoyable reading as well as an insightful look at possibilities for tomorrow's teachers.
